Voting opened Friday in Russia's three-day parliamentary election, which President Vladimir Putin has framed as a test of public support for the war in Ukraine. The vote comes as fuel shortages, high interest rates, a labour crunch and Western sanctions squeeze the Russian economy, with the ruling United Russia party expected to keep its dominance in a tightly controlled contest.

Voting got underway on Friday in a three-day parliamentary election that Putin has cast as a barometer of support for the war. It is the first parliamentary election since Russia launched its full-scale invasion of Ukraine in February 2022.

The vote will determine the make-up of the 450-seat State Duma, the lower house of parliament, and is widely expected to see the pro-Putin United Russia party retain its dominance in a tightly controlled political system. Most anti-war candidates have been excluded from the ballot after the Supreme Court ruled that the liberal Yabloko party, which wants a ceasefire, had breached electoral rules, though some Yabloko candidates are still running in individual constituencies.

Putin told the nation ahead of the vote that casting a ballot would help secure Russia's victory in Ukraine and demonstrate national resolve against external pressure. The Kremlin says national unity matters because Ukraine's intelligence services and other enemies are trying to stir unrest inside Russia.

Yet the vote lands as opinion polls show some Russians growing more anxious about how the conflict affects them. Fuel shortages caused by Ukrainian drone strikes are roiling parts of the country, and businesses are contending with high interest rates, a labour crunch and Western sanctions — a mix authorities are expected to use the vote to gauge the depth of society's war weariness.

Initial and partial results are expected to start trickling out at 1800 GMT on Sunday, with near-complete results due Monday.
